Un nuevo sistema de IA, la Red de Categorización de Apiñamiento Dental (DCC-Net), categoriza con precisión el apiñamiento dental a partir de fotografías intraorales. Esta herramienta ayuda a los ortodoncistas en el diagnóstico y la planificación del tratamiento, mejorando la precisión tanto para los profesionales experimentados como para los principiantes.

Avoidance Learning and Learned Helplessness
Avoidance learning occurs when an organism learns that a specific behavior can prevent an unpleasant outcome. For example, a student who receives a bad grade may start studying harder to avoid future poor grades. This behavior persists even when the negative outcome is no longer present.
